当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一个服务器如何放两个网站使用的,如何在一个服务器上部署两个网站,高效整合与优化方案

一个服务器如何放两个网站使用的,如何在一个服务器上部署两个网站,高效整合与优化方案

在一个服务器上部署两个网站,可使用虚拟主机或容器技术。虚拟主机通过分配独立IP和端口实现,容器技术如Docker则通过隔离环境实现高效整合。优化方案包括合理分配资源、优...

在一个服务器上部署两个网站,可使用虚拟主机或容器技术。虚拟主机通过分配独立IP和端口实现,容器技术如Docker则通过隔离环境实现高效整合。优化方案包括合理分配资源、优化代码与数据库、使用CDN加速,确保网站稳定高效运行。

随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,对于一些中小企业或个人来说,购买多台服务器进行部署可能会增加成本,如何在一个服务器上部署两个网站呢?本文将为您详细介绍在一个服务器上部署两个网站的方法,帮助您实现高效整合与优化。

在一个服务器上部署两个网站的方法

1、购买服务器

一个服务器如何放两个网站使用的,如何在一个服务器上部署两个网站,高效整合与优化方案

您需要购买一台服务器,根据您的需求,选择合适的配置,一般而言,服务器需要具备以下配置:

(1)CPU:至少2核,建议4核以上;

(2)内存:至少4GB,建议8GB以上;

(3)硬盘:至少500GB,建议1TB以上;

(4)带宽:根据网站流量需求选择,建议100Mbps以上。

2、安装操作系统

购买服务器后,您需要安装操作系统,目前市场上主流的服务器操作系统有Windows Server和Linux,根据您的喜好和需求,选择合适的操作系统进行安装。

3、安装Web服务器软件

Web服务器软件是用于处理网站请求的软件,常见的Web服务器软件有IIS、Apache和Nginx,以下分别介绍如何安装这些软件:

(1)IIS:在Windows Server上,您可以打开“服务器管理器”,选择“添加角色和功能”,然后选择“Web服务器(IIS)”,按照提示完成安装。

(2)Apache:在Linux上,您可以使用以下命令安装Apache:

sudo apt-get update
sudo apt-get install apache2

(3)Nginx:在Linux上,您可以使用以下命令安装Nginx:

sudo apt-get update
sudo apt-get install nginx

4、配置域名解析

为了访问您的网站,您需要在域名解析服务商处将域名解析到服务器IP地址,具体操作如下:

(1)登录域名解析服务商网站;

一个服务器如何放两个网站使用的,如何在一个服务器上部署两个网站,高效整合与优化方案

(2)找到您的域名,点击“解析设置”;

(3)添加一条A记录,将域名解析到服务器IP地址。

5、部署网站

将您的网站源码上传到服务器,具体操作如下:

(1)登录服务器;

(2)使用FTP或SSH等工具上传网站源码到服务器上的指定目录;

(3)确保网站源码的权限正确,如设置可读、可写和可执行权限。

6、配置Web服务器

根据您所使用的Web服务器软件,配置虚拟主机,以下分别介绍IIS、Apache和Nginx的配置方法:

(1)IIS:在“服务器管理器”中,选择“网站”,点击“添加网站”,按照提示完成配置。

(2)Apache:在Apache的配置文件中(如Linux上的/etc/apache2/sites-available/目录),添加一个新的虚拟主机配置文件,并配置相应的域名和目录。

(3)Nginx:在Nginx的配置文件中(如Linux上的/etc/nginx/sites-available/目录),添加一个新的虚拟主机配置文件,并配置相应的域名和目录。

7、重启Web服务器

完成配置后,重启Web服务器以使配置生效,以下分别介绍IIS、Apache和Nginx的重启方法:

(1)IIS:在“服务器管理器”中,选择“IIS管理器”,找到您的网站,点击“重启”按钮。

一个服务器如何放两个网站使用的,如何在一个服务器上部署两个网站,高效整合与优化方案

(2)Apache:在Linux上,使用以下命令重启Apache:

sudo systemctl restart apache2

(3)Nginx:在Linux上,使用以下命令重启Nginx:

sudo systemctl restart nginx

8、测试网站

在浏览器中输入您的域名,如果能够成功访问两个网站,说明部署成功。

优化与整合

1、资源分配

为了确保两个网站都能正常运行,您需要对服务器资源进行合理分配,您可以为每个网站分配不同的内存、CPU和带宽等。

2、安全防护

部署两个网站时,要注意网络安全防护,安装防火墙、设置安全策略、定期更新服务器系统和软件等。

3、网站优化

针对两个网站,进行相应的优化,提高网站访问速度和用户体验,优化图片、CSS和JavaScript等。

4、网站备份

定期备份两个网站的数据,以防数据丢失。

在一个服务器上部署两个网站,可以帮助您降低成本,提高资源利用率,通过以上方法,您可以在一个服务器上成功部署两个网站,并实现高效整合与优化,在实际操作过程中,根据您的需求和实际情况进行调整,以确保网站稳定运行。

黑狐家游戏

发表评论

最新文章